"The Stolen White Elephant" by Mark Twain is a short story published in 1882. A valuable Siamese white elephant, traveling as a diplomatic gift to the Queen of Britain, mysteriously vanishes in New Jersey. Chief Inspector Blunt and the local police department launch an intense investigation to recover the missing animal. This detective mystery follows their desperate search through mounting complications, leading toward an unexpected and tragic conclusion.
